Protein Construction:

A DNA sequence encoding the cynomolgus IL18RAP (F7HHC1) (Met1-Arg356) was expressed, fused with the Fc region of human IgG1 at the C-terminus.

Source: Cynomolgus
Expression Host: Human Cells

Molecular Mass:

The recombinant cynomolgus IL18RAP is a disulfide-linked homodimer. The reduced monomer comprises 578 amino acids and has a calculated molecular mass of 65.4 KDa.The apparent molecular mass of the protein is approximately 92 KDa respectively in SDS-PAGE.

IL18RAP Protein Description

Interleukin 18 receptor accessory protein, also known as IL18RAP, IL1R7 and CDw218b, is a single-pass type I  membrane protein. It is member of the interleukin-1 receptor family. IL18RAP contains 2 Ig-like C2-type (immunoglobulin-like) domains and 1 TIR domain. IL18RAP is strongly expressed in peripheral blood leukocytes, spleen, lung, and, to a lesser extent, in colon. It is not expressed in any other tissue tested. IL18RAP is also strongly expressed in T-cells polarized with IL12 and specifically coexpressed with IL18R1 in Th1 cells. IL18RAP is an accessory subunit of the heterodimeric receptor for IL18. This protein enhances the IL18 binding activity of IL18R1, the ligand binding subunit of IL18 receptor. The coexpression of IL18R1 and IL18RAP is required for the activation of NF-κB and MAPK8 (JNK) in response to IL18. Variants at IL18RAP have been linked to susceptibility to coeliac disease.
